In Bavaria the dirndl and woollen jackets are equally typical articles of smart attire as a suit, dinner jacket or little black dress. This Miesbach Woman, designed by Resl Schröder-Lechner in 1937, shows just how intricate and special the traditional costumes, mostly handmade, are to this day. Wholly in keeping, in formal terms, with the tradition of 19th-century Alpine genre figures, this vivacious figure with her delicately formed features slightly resembles the Austrian artist, who died in 2000, who made her.
